SiFT
Standard Lithium continues to develop novel and innovative technologies. This includes its Selective Inline Fractionation Technology (‘SiFT’) process to produce high purity battery grade lithium carbonate from lithium chloride.
This fully automated lithium carbonate plant has been designed around proprietary continuous fractional crystallization technology, which has demonstrated to produce greater than 99.9% purity (also known as ‘three-nines’) battery quality lithium carbonate. The crystallization plant was constructed at Saltworks Technologies Inc. in Vancouver, B.C. The plant was commissioned with lithium chloride produced at Standard Lithium’s Demonstration Plant, as well as reprocessing technical grade lithium carbonate sourced from South American brine operations into battery quality lithium carbonate. Post commissioning the SiFT plant, it was transported to Arkansas and installed at Standard Lithium’s existing Demonstration Plant.
The SiFT plant is hydraulically integrated with the Standard Lithium’s existing operating DLE Demonstration Plant, making full use of instrumentation, control, reagent, and process-flow connections. At site, the SiFT process has successfully produced greater than 99.9% purity battery-quality lithium carbonate using lithium chloride produced from Smackover Formation brine.
With the implementation of SiFT plant, Standard Lithium achieved the first and only continuous, 24 hours per day, 7 days per week, start-to-finish brine-to-carbonate plant in North America.
